Technical Considerations and Fabric Challenges
However, no design is without its technical hurdles. When working with the FUNNY ANNIVERSARY GIFT for HUSBAND file, attention must be paid to the substrate. If you are attempting this on a textured fabric like a waffle knit or a rough linen tea towel, the finer details might get lost. In such cases, increasing the stitch density slightly or using a heavier cut-away stabilizer can prevent the fabric from puckering and ensure the letters remain crisp.
Curved surfaces present another challenge. If you decide to apply this to a cap or a hat, the curvature of the front panel can distort wide text. You must ensure the hoop size you select allows for proper framing without stretching the fabric too tightly, which can cause registration issues after the hoop is removed. Additionally, if the design includes tiny lettering or intricate corners, these are the first areas to suffer on stretchy fabrics like jersey knits. Always test on scrap fabric first. Check how the running stitch outlines behave on dark versus light backgrounds; sometimes a design that looks great in color needs a slight underlay adjustment when stitched in black on black.

Final Designer Notes and Best Practices
Before committing to a full production run or listing this as a new item in your store, there are several practical steps to take. First, verify the licensing terms. While this is a graphic intended for POD and crafts, confirm whether it allows for unlimited commercial use or if there are restrictions on the number of physical sales. Next, review the file formats provided. Ensure you have the correct digital embroidery file extensions compatible with your specific machine brand.
Conduct a thorough color test. Create mockups in both black and white to see how the design relies on color for definition. If the design loses its impact without color, you may need to adjust the stitch types or add outlining. Finally, consider the end-user's lifestyle. Will this personalized product be washed frequently? If so, recommend care instructions that preserve the integrity of the stitches, such as washing inside out and avoiding high heat.
